3D05
Human p53 core domain with hot spot mutation R249S (II)
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| ESRF BEAMLINE ID29 |
| Synchrotron site | ESRF |
| Beamline | ID29 |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2004-12-06 |
| Detector | ADSC QUANTUM 210 |
| Wavelength(s) | 0.9760 |
| Spacegroup name | P 65 2 2 |
| Unit cell lengths | 44.374, 44.374, 330.026 |
| Unit cell angles | 90.00, 90.00, 120.00 |
Refinement procedure
| Resolution | 34.840 - 1.700 |
| R-factor | 0.22053 |
| Rwork | 0.218 |
| R-free | 0.26383 |
| Structure solution method | MOLECULAR REPLACEMENT |
| Starting model (for MR) | 1tsr |
| RMSD bond length | 0.012 |
| RMSD bond angle | 1.341 |
| Data reduction software | HKL-2000 |
| Data scaling software | HKL-2000 |
| Phasing software | MOLREP |
| Refinement software | REFMAC (5.2.0019) |
Data quality characteristics
| Overall | Outer shell | |
| Low resolution limit [Å] | 35.000 | 1.740 |
| High resolution limit [Å] | 1.700 | 1.700 |
| Number of reflections | 22189 | |
| <I/σ(I)> | 22.9 | 5.1 |
| Completeness [%] | 96.6 | 84 |
| Redundancy | 7.8 | 4.6 |
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 6.1 | 293 | 0.2M Sodium Acetate, 20% PEG 3350, pH 6.1, VAPOR DIFFUSION, HANGING DROP, temperature 293K |
